Born and raised in Bangkok, Thailand, with Indian heritage, Ria experienced a culturally rich and diverse upbringing that cultivated her appreciation for the arts. She formally decided to take singing lessons at the age of 8. Ria’s passion for dance also flourished, with her speciality being in hip-hop and street styles.
Ria continued to hone her skills at the American Musical and Dramatic Academy in New York City, learning how to infuse sensitivity and vulnerability into honest storytelling.
She currently works for two-time Tony Award-winning Broadway production company Fran Kirmser LLC and Bessie Award-nominated J CHEN PROJECT. Her most notable credits include Sandy Dumbrowski (Grease), Darlene Purvis (Honky Tonk Angels), and Miranda (The Tempest) in the Weathervane Theatre’s 60th season.
